All startups will be reviewed by our startup’s team. If approved, they will be assigned to the relevant track (ALPHA or BETA.) Please see the criteria below
ALPHA – To qualify for the ALPHA track the startup can have raised no more than US$1 million in funding.
BETA – To qualify for the BETA track the startup can have raised no more than US$3 million in funding.
*Startups that have raised more than US$3 million cannot participate in partner startup islands.*
Startups must meet the following requirements to be accepted:
Must be less than 5 years old.
Must have their own unique software product or solutions or they must be working on their own connected hardware devices.
Consultancies, agencies, developers, marketing/advertising agencies, public companies will not be accepted.
Startups must be their own independent company and not a subsidiary of a larger organisation.
The startup must be launched and live with their own working website at a minimum.
The startup cannot already be registered to exhibit at the event.
The startup must have a logo available in .eps format.
Startups submitted that do not meet the above criteria will not be accepted and can cause delays in onboarding of approved startups.
For any unsuccessful startups, partners will be given the opportunity to find replacements within an agreed timeline. If a partner remains with unused startup packages by October 1st, the packages will be exchanged for three general attendee tickets.

Startups can apply for the following activations:
PITCH is Web Summit’s startup competition, highlighting the world’s most promising startups in a pitching battle. The closing date for PITCH applications will be communicated to each startup in an email from their dedicated startup success manager.
Startup Showcase is a highly popular startup activation at Web Summit. Startups will have two minutes on stage to showcase their company to the audience. Be sure to expect quickfire presentations of startups’ solutions to the biggest issues within their fields.
Each hour will see our top startups take to the stage to present under a different theme, covering a variety of exhibition industries and current trends, such as the Future of Work, Security & Future of Content. The closing date for Startup Showcase applications will be communicated to each startup in an email from their dedicated startup success manager.
Mentor Hours is a series of pre-scheduled, hour-long group meetings between our high-level attendees and selected startups. Mentor Hours have four distinct tracks: lead, engage, build and grow. Each track has a specific focus and carefully selected mentors to ensure the issues discussed are relevant for the startups. |
Each startup will receive a link to apply from their startup success manager. The closing date for Mentor Hours applications will be communicated to each startup in an email from their dedicated startup success manager.

Startup Sessions take place in the run-up to Web Summit. These digital webinars run for 45 minutes and are hosted by business experts and leaders in the tech industry. The format of each session is a 30-minute interactive discussion followed by a 15-minute Q&A.
Startups will receive invitations to join upcoming Startup Sessions from their startup success managers. A schedule for our Startup Sessions can be found below:

Startup masterclasses at Web Summit focus on different growth paths, discussing everything from the corporate innovation explosion to the ‘must-knows’ of GDPR and the best ways to secure funding. Startup masterclasses run throughout Web Summit.
All participating startups will receive a signup link from their startup success manager.
Investor Meetings is a series of pre-scheduled,15-minute meetings between the biggest investors in tech and the leading startups attending Web Summit. Startups are automatically added to our investor meetings portal.
This is where our attending investors view our startup profiles and select the startups they would most like to meet. If selected, the startup will be contacted by their startup success manager.
